Revoy EV, a San Francisco-based trucking startup, raised $27 million in a Series A round led by Standard Capital, with Doerr Capital, Time Ventures, Y Combinator, and Leap Ventures participating, according to Dealroom.
The company's system packs batteries and an electric drive axle into a tandem trailer that fits between a conventional semi truck and its trailer, aiming to electrify diesel semis in minutes without replacing the truck itself.
Revoy claims the retrofit can cut a fleet's fuel bill in half, and after years of development the concept is now taking real steps toward production.
